What Is GHRP-6 Overdose Symptoms And Management?

GHRP-6 overdose refers to the administration of this peptide in quantities exceeding the recommended therapeutic or supplemental doses, resulting in adverse physiological effects. GHRP-6 is a synthetic hexapeptide known for its ability to stimulate endogenous GH release by acting on the pituitary gland and hypothalamus. When taken in excessively high doses, the peptide can disrupt normal hormonal balance and cause multiple symptoms ranging from mild discomfort to serious health complications.

Symptoms of GHRP-6 overdose commonly include excessive hunger, water retention, joint pain, elevated cortisol levels, increased prolactin secretion, and in severe cases, symptoms related to hypoglycemia or cardiovascular strain. Effective management of overdose involves prompt recognition of these symptoms, discontinuation of GHRP-6, supportive care to mitigate symptoms, and monitoring for complications.

How It Works

GHRP-6 functions as a growth hormone secretagogue, meaning it stimulates the secretion of growth hormone from the anterior pituitary gland. It mimics the action of ghrelin, a natural hormone that binds to the growth hormone secretagogue receptor (GHS-R) in the hypothalamus and pituitary. This binding triggers the release of GH, which in turn promotes tissue growth, metabolism regulation, and cellular repair.

Mechanistically, GHRP-6 bypasses the normal feedback inhibition by somatostatin, thereby enhancing pulsatile GH release. However, excessive stimulation from an overdose can lead to hormonal imbalances such as increased cortisol and prolactin, which are secondary effects of overstimulation of the hypothalamic-pituitary axis.

    Side Effects & Safety

    While GHRP-6 is generally well-tolerated, side effects are dose-dependent and more pronounced at higher or excessive doses. Below is a comparative table summarizing common side effects and those specifically associated with overdose:

    | Side Effect | Typical Dose Occurrence | Overdose Severity |

    |----------------------|------------------------------|----------------------------|

    | Increased Appetite | Common | Excessive and uncontrollable|

    | Water Retention | Mild | Severe edema possible |

    | Joint Pain | Occasionally | Persistent and debilitating |

    | Elevated Cortisol | Rare | Significant hormonal imbalance |

    | Prolactin Increase | Rare | May cause gynecomastia |

    | Hypoglycemia | Uncommon | Possible with large overdoses |

    | Fatigue | Mild | Pronounced |

    Careful monitoring and adherence to dosing are essential to maintain safety.

  • Frequently Asked Questions

    Q1: What are the first signs of GHRP-6 overdose?

    A: Excessive hunger, swelling, joint pain, and fatigue are common initial signs indicating possible overdose.

    Q2: Can GHRP-6 overdose be life-threatening?

    A: While rare, severe overdose may lead to significant hormonal imbalances and cardiovascular strain, requiring immediate medical attention.

    Q3: How is GHRP-6 overdose treated?

    A: Treatment involves discontinuing GHRP-6, supportive care for symptoms (e.g., hydration, pain management), and monitoring hormonal levels.

    Q4: Is there an antidote for GHRP-6 overdose?

    A: No specific antidote exists; management is symptomatic and supportive.

    Q5: How can overdose be prevented?

    A: Strict adherence to dosing guidelines, avoiding self-experimentation with high doses, and consulting healthcare professionals is crucial.
